Method of Designing Echo Canceller with Orthogonal ECLMS Algorithm

机译:正交ECLMS算法设计回声消除器的方法

摘要

In the echo cancellation, the double-talk situation when both the near-end signal and far-end signal are presented degrades the performance of echo cancellation using the LMS algorithm or the NLMS algorithm. The ECLMS algorithm has been proposed to solve the double-talk problem. The characteristics of the ECLMS algorithm is using the correlation function of the input signal itself. On the other hand, the lattice structure has a attractive characteristics that the backward residuals are orthogonal to each other. The purpose of this paper is to derive an Orthognal-ECLMS algorithm utilizing the backward residuals of lattice structure.
